How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Casnovia?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Casnovia Studio Apartments | $1,215 | $970 | $1,910 |
Casnovia 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,491 | $379 | $2,446 |
Casnovia 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,757 | $519 | $3,429 |
Casnovia 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,363 | $699 | $3,623 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Casnovia Apartments with Washer/Dryer
How much is the average rent for Casnovia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in Casnovia with Washer/Dryer is $1,744.
What is the largest Casnovia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in Casnovia is a 1,993 square feet unit starting from $1,850 at The Valley.
What is the average size for Casnovia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in Casnovia is currently at 777 sq ft.
